[Music] germany 1483 [Music] a time of desolation and disease where the plague could wipe out entire towns in days and a quarter of all children died before they were five [Music] in this world there was one great consolation the church and its promise of heaven
this promise had made the church the most powerful institution on earth [Music] rich beyond counting mightier than kings but also corrupt and tyrannical an empire that would be overturned by one man martin luther [Music] this is the story of a man swept from devotion to rebellion [Music] of a quest that would set old europe of
fire spread revolution across nations and unleash a voice of freedom that still resounds through the modern world [Music]
[Music] i think it's impossible to write the history of modern western culture without talking about luther the idea that we should stand up for the things that we believe in the idea that every person is precious in the sight of god these are things that we take for granted but they were things that luther had to
fight for [Music] luther has to be ranked with the great emancipators of human history through the emphasis on the individual the courage of the individual and the willingness of the individual to undergo death for his beliefs [Music] he took on the catholic church this immense and enduring institution and said you are wrong
let us now come to the right there are very few cases where you have one individual standing literally before the arrayed might of the world and saying nope i won't back down
